Quality Engineer

Neuchâtel, Switzerland

Full-time / Fixed Term Contract

Position Overview

The Quality Engineer applies intermediate Quality Engineering/Scientific Method techniques and principles to daily tasks and activities. In addition, applies relevant regulations, standards, and industry best practices to assignments. Plans and conducts projects and assignments with technical responsibility or strategic input. Receives intermittent, moderately detailed instructions from technical Quality leaders at various levels, in addition to other stakeholders.

Tasks & Responsibilities
  • Utilize quality engineering principles and problem-solving skills to develop and optimize products/processes. Utilize statistical tools and techniques to establish sampling plans
  • Develop and implement control plans consistent with product classification, potential defect types, defect frequency, severity, patient risk, process capability, process controls, etc.
  • Develop and implement appropriate process monitoring and control methods consistent with the level of process/product risk
  • Support Base Business and Production Improvement Initiatives
  • Ensure that Test Methods and Quality procedures are executed in compliance with specifications and standards. Work in development, writing, updating and review of test methods, SOPs, protocols, and specifications as required
  • Provide guidance to project teams and business partners to ensure compliance with company policies and procedures as well as medical device regulations
  • Monitor quality data and metrics on a regular basis to that ensure appropriate investigation, correction action, and/or escalation is conducted as required for recurring trends. Analyzes process-, product-, test-, Lab- and Quality Management System data and investigates for improvement opportunities
  • Responsible for communicating business related issues or opportunities to next management level
  • For those who supervise or manage a staff, responsible for ensuring that subordinates follow all Company guidelines related to Health, Safety and Environmental practices and that all resources needed to do so are available and in good condition, if applicable
  • Responsible for ensuring personal and Company compliance with all Federal, State, local and Company regulations, policies, and procedures
  • Performs other duties assigned as needed

Qualifications
  • University Bachelor’s Degree or Equivalent in Engineering or Science required
  • Quality background with up to 2 to 3 years in industry, preferred in medical field
  • Quality and Statistical tools knowledge
  • Technical training and experience using Risk analysis (DFMEA, PFMEA), Statistics, Lean and Six Sigma Methodologies is required including Measurement System Analysis, DOEs, Gage R&R, etc.
  • Knowledge of statistical software packages is preferred with the ability to preview, graph and analyze data in order to present data that facilitates/drives decision making
  • Understand of NPI (New Product Introduction) process and Process Validation expertise is preferred
  • Good level in written and spoken English. French is desirable
  • Proactive and able to take decisions
  • Well organized and systematic approach to issues
  • Able to work in a team
  • Able to identify and simplify complex issues
  • Good interpersonal, organization, and oral/written communication skills
